## RateLens parity checker — quick restart

If RateLens starts flagging every property at the Bramblewood chain as out-of-parity, it's almost always a stale scrape cache, not an actual pricing war. Bounce the worker pool first, then clear the comparison cache before you panic-page the pricing team. The checker picks up its settings fresh on restart, so verify them before kicking anything. Here are the config values the service currently runs with.

config for bawig-fadup:
[zorix]
host = zorix.lumicworks.corp
user = zorix_svc
database = zorix_prod

## Releases

PayRill retry workers require idempotency keys on every payment attempt — no key, no retry, full stop. Release artifacts are built by the Cobblefen pipeline and signed before publish. Never hand-roll a build. Pull the tagged tarball, check the idempotency middleware version matches the tag, then verify the signature. Verification requires the current release key, shown below.

release key, fahaf-bajof: bky3_Xam

Visitors to the Brellan Works prototype workshop on Level 2 must be pre-registered by their host and sign in at the facilities desk on arrival. Safety glasses are mandatory past the yellow line, and no photography is permitted near active builds. Hosts are responsible for their visitors at all times and must walk them back to reception when the session ends. Workshop access outside staffed hours requires a facilities escort. If a visitor needs unescorted entry for a multi-day build, issue the temporary pass below.

staff pass of kawip-hawef = bdg-QLP-2

Test plan: flaky integration tests, Tollgate payments service. Failures cluster around settlement retries hitting the sandbox ledger after 30s timeouts. Support: if a customer escalation cites test env errors, check the Brindle dashboard first. We rerun the suite nightly; quarantine anything failing twice. Do not restart the ledger pod manually. To query the sandbox status endpoint yourself, authenticate with the bearer token below:

portal login ticket: eyJhbGciOiJIUzI1NiIsInR5cCI6IkpXVCJ9.eyJzdWIiOiIwEOsktwVNwIn0.-UJU3fdyyCgG